Definition of washes
- the erosive process of washing away soil or gravel by water (as from a roadway) (noun)
Examples
- from the house they watched the washout of their newly seeded lawn by the water
Synonyms
- washout
- make moist (verb)
Synonyms
- dampen
- moisten
- the flow of air that is driven backwards by an aircraft propeller (noun)
Synonyms
- airstream
- backwash
- race
- slipstream
- garments or white goods that can be cleaned by laundering (noun)
Synonyms
- laundry
- washables
- washing
- cleanse with a cleaning agent, such as soap, and water (verb)
Synonyms
- launder
- remove by the application of water or other liquid and soap or some other cleaning agent (verb)
Examples
- he washed the dirt from his coat
- The nurse washed away the blood
- Can you wash away the spots on the windows?
- he managed to wash out the stains
Synonyms
- wash away
- wash off
- wash out
- the work of cleansing (usually with soap and water) (noun)
Synonyms
- lavation
- washing
- wash or flow against (verb)
Synonyms
- lap
- lave
- clean with some chemical process (verb)
Synonyms
- rinse
- the dry bed of an intermittent stream (as at the bottom of a canyon) (noun)
Synonyms
- dry wash
- a watercolor made by applying a series of monochrome washes one over the other (noun)
Synonyms
- wash drawing
- cleanse (one's body) with soap and water (verb)
Synonyms
- lave
- admit to testing or proof (verb)
Examples
- This silly excuse won't wash in traffic court
- any enterprise in which losses and gains cancel out (noun)
Examples
- at the end of the year the accounting department showed that it was a wash
- apply a thin coating of paint, metal, etc., to (verb)
- a thin coat of water-base paint (noun)
- be capable of being washed (verb)
Examples
- Does this material wash?
- form by erosion (verb)
Examples
- The river washed a ravine into the mountainside
- move by or as if by water (verb)
Examples
- The swollen river washed away the footbridge
- separate dirt or gravel from (precious minerals) (verb)
- to cleanse (itself or another animal) by licking (verb)
Examples
- The cat washes several times a day
